summaryrefslogtreecommitdiffstats
path: root/sys/netatalk
diff options
context:
space:
mode:
authorrwatson <rwatson@FreeBSD.org>2005-02-18 10:53:00 +0000
committerrwatson <rwatson@FreeBSD.org>2005-02-18 10:53:00 +0000
commit0724e80aff75438f2021ff025fa2b2554cac866d (patch)
tree59bcf784fc8cb3f1aa5f3f50d7ffa41fe6c96036 /sys/netatalk
parent9fe3efa6c31145b629b559e82b556b3637f04334 (diff)
downloadFreeBSD-src-0724e80aff75438f2021ff025fa2b2554cac866d.zip
FreeBSD-src-0724e80aff75438f2021ff025fa2b2554cac866d.tar.gz
Run the netatalk netisrs without Giant.
MFC after: 1 week
Diffstat (limited to 'sys/netatalk')
-rw-r--r--sys/netatalk/ddp_usrreq.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/sys/netatalk/ddp_usrreq.c b/sys/netatalk/ddp_usrreq.c
index ac733ae..e3bde16 100644
--- a/sys/netatalk/ddp_usrreq.c
+++ b/sys/netatalk/ddp_usrreq.c
@@ -1,5 +1,5 @@
/*-
- * Copyright (c) 2004 Robert N. M. Watson
+ * Copyright (c) 2004-2005 Robert N. M. Watson
* Copyright (c) 1990,1994 Regents of The University of Michigan.
* All Rights Reserved.
*
@@ -239,9 +239,9 @@ ddp_init(void)
mtx_init(&atintrq2.ifq_mtx, "at2_inq", NULL, MTX_DEF);
mtx_init(&aarpintrq.ifq_mtx, "aarp_inq", NULL, MTX_DEF);
DDP_LIST_LOCK_INIT();
- netisr_register(NETISR_ATALK1, at1intr, &atintrq1, 0);
- netisr_register(NETISR_ATALK2, at2intr, &atintrq2, 0);
- netisr_register(NETISR_AARP, aarpintr, &aarpintrq, 0);
+ netisr_register(NETISR_ATALK1, at1intr, &atintrq1, NETISR_MPSAFE);
+ netisr_register(NETISR_ATALK2, at2intr, &atintrq2, NETISR_MPSAFE);
+ netisr_register(NETISR_AARP, aarpintr, &aarpintrq, NETISR_MPSAFE);
}
#if 0
OpenPOWER on IntegriCloud